Arrow Shiba League Needs Two!

The Shiba League, currently in its 27th season, needs owners for the Montreal Royals and Los Angeles Angels. We use real MLB players. We are currently in the 1973 season.

The Shiba League started in March of 2002 with OOTP4; we're currently using v6.5. We have no immediate plans to migrate to OOTP2006.

The Royals are at the bottom of the heap, but with players like Dewey Evans and George Brett in their minors, they're only a few years away from competing. The Angels have a solid offense, led by Tony Conigliaro, but are in dire need of some pitching. A much easier project than the Royals, most likely.

Coaches and scouts are turned off.

Here are a few unique items about the league:

Financials

The financials are screwed down fairly tightly. Change that -- very tightly. It seems that most leagues pay lip service to financials, but it is a key part of the Shiba league. Managing your finances is as important as drafting effectively and trading shrewdly. Letting your payroll get out of hand will definitely drive your team into the ground.

Contract extensions are done by an "arbitration" spreadsheet which can be found on the main page. Once the player's details have been entered, the file returns the corresponding contract requirements for a 1-5 year deal. These amounts are 'take it or leave it.' There are no negotiations with extensions. This is mainly meant to save time by avoiding the 'three strikes and you're out' extension process that's used with the OOTP game.


League Structure

Originally we tried to maintain historical accuracy with franchise moves, ballparks, and league size/structure. As the league has matured, sticking to the late 60's format has become at little tedious. We are currently organized into two league of seven teams. Before the 1967 season, we 'migrated' all exisiting American League and National League teams to Pacific Coast League and International League teams. The change was solely cosmetic.

As the availability (or lack) of quality owners dictates, we'll expand/contract the league as necessary.

Sim Schedule

Sims are typically held on Monday, Wednesdays, and Fridays. During the bulk of the season we sim 2 weeks worth of games at a time. Seasons typically last 6-7 weeks including the post-season and off-season.
